Transaction 7560dac4b90f91cff86372d635a4a70f9d7bb93c0572b019cc66a25c2720835d
1 Input
1 Output
-
7560dac4b90f91cff86372d635a4a70f9d7bb93c0572b019cc66a25c2720835d:0
- value
- 1362600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e249142b26dd4653b0c5b0e6750849abc07e5f91 OP_EQUAL
- address
- 3NKWBVyKqw3uG5zYUDk5pkdPcU2Dwcv542